Doosan Infracore, which enjoys a strong presence in China, plans to increase this year? exports of lift trucks to Europe 14% over last year? figure to reach US$100 million. To this end, the company is introducing new models and strengthening its marketing efforts.

Doosan Infracore Strategy & Innovation Chief & President Kim Yong-sung and Management Support Division Chief Shin Oh-shik were promoted to CEO, which means that the company now has four chief executive officers, including President Choe Sung-chul and Chairman Park Yong-man.
